This was quite interesting in the Bit Tech review:

However, it's questionable whether you seriously need that much graphics performance. With the PC games industry tied down by games that need to be developed for ageing consoles, you won't benefit from this sort of graphics power unless you use very high resolutions. A quick glance at the performance in games such as Skyrim or Dirt 3 at 1,920 x 1,080 is enough to tell you that, for most titles, a cheaper card delivers equally playable results.

Regardless, you'd arguably be foolish (or perhaps an AMD fanboy) to jump the 28nm gun so quickly. Nvidia will respond with its own 28nm Kepler parts around March/April (to coincide with Ivy Bridge, we believe) and

we expect new GPUs from AMD between January and March too.

It's not worth buying one to put up the backside of a 1080p monitor no. Absolutely not.

However, most of the "easter eggs" that the card has come up with are solely aimed at 3 screen users.

And I can tell you from running 3 myself, it fixes the absolute worst of them, by allowing you to have your task bar and main windows in the middle screen so that you don't need to turn your mouse to like 10,000 DPI in order to span the screens.

Three screens are currently laid out so absolutely terribly (it's a bodge using the WDHM or whatever the heck it's called that Win 7 uses) that I built a second PC just for three screen gaming. It's absolutely awesome, but living with the desktop layout would have driven me to an early grave.
